About this role
As a Finance Systems Engineer at Go1, you will be responsible for enhancing and maintaining the NetSuite order-to-cash workflows, ensuring reliability and efficiency in financial operations. You will collaborate with various teams to design and implement system improvements, troubleshoot issues, and support integrations while also focusing on AI-assisted enhancements. Your role will involve end-to-end ownership of processes, from invoicing to reconciliation, and you will play a key part in driving operational excellence in finance systems.

What you need
- Four or more years of experience in finance systems, business systems, SaaS operations, or integration engineering
- Hands-on NetSuite experience with a strong understanding of operational-finance and order-to-cash processes
- Experience designing and supporting APIs, webhooks, integrations, or workflow automation in a production environment
- Working knowledge of invoices, payments, refunds, reconciliation, revenue dates, multi-currency considerations, and the downstream impact of system changes
- Experience supporting indirect-tax processes and tax-system integrations, such as Vertex or a comparable tax engine
- A methodical approach to testing, exception handling, documentation, and operational support
Nice to have
- Experience with a CRM, billing, payments, collections, tax, procurement, or other finance-adjacent system
- SQL, SuiteQL, Python, JavaScript, or TypeScript used for data investigation, validation, integrations, or internal tools
- Experience in a subscription, SaaS, or multi-entity operating environment
